Commercial Tree Removal in Reno, NV
Commercial tree removal services involve the careful and efficient removal of trees from commercial properties, including parking lots, office complexes, retail centers, and industrial sites. These projects often require the removal of hazardous, dead, or overgrown trees that pose safety risks or interfere with property development and maintenance. Property owners typically seek this service to improve site safety, comply with local regulations, or prepare land for construction or landscaping projects, ensuring that trees are removed safely and responsibly.
Before requesting commercial tree removal, property owners should consider factors such as the size and location of the trees, proximity to buildings or power lines, and any potential impact on surrounding areas. It is also important to understand the scope of the work, including whether stump grinding or debris removal is included.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can help ensure the process proceeds smoothly and meets the specific needs of the property.

Commercial Tree Removal Questions
When is commercial tree removal necessary? Tree removal may be needed to prevent property damage, clear space for construction, or remove dead or hazardous trees.
What types of trees are commonly removed on commercial properties? Commonly removed trees include large shade trees, diseased or dying trees, and those obstructing views or structures.
How does tree removal impact property safety? Removing problematic trees reduces the risk of falling branches or trees, helping to maintain a safe environment on the property.
What should property owners consider before scheduling tree removal? Consider the tree's location, size, condition, and potential impact on surrounding structures or utilities.
